Sawali Kh. Village - Aundha (Nagnath), Hingoli

Sawali Kh. is a village situated in the Aundha (Nagnath) tehsil of Hingoli district, Maharashtra. It is located approximately 60 km from the tehsil headquarters in Aundha (nagnath) and around 40 km from the district headquarters in Hingoli. Savali Kh serves as the Gram Panchayat for Sawali Kh. village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Sawali Kh. is 546092. The village covers a total geographical area of 789 hectares and falls under the 431705 pincode. Jintur is the nearest town, located about 10 km away.

Sawali Kh. village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Basmath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Hingoli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Sawali Kh.

As per Census 2011, Sawali Kh. village has a total population of 1,029 people, consisting of 530 males and 499 females. The village has 183 households and a sex ratio of 941 females per 1,000 males. There are 153 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 652 literate and 377 illiterate residents. Additionally, 155 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Sawali Kh.

Public transport in the Sawali Kh. is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is Junona Halt, while the nearest airport is Nanded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 47.9 km.

In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Jintur to Sawali Kh. is about 10 km, with a usual travel time of around 15-30 minutes. Similarly, the road distance from Hingoli to Sawali Kh. is about 40 km, with the usual travel time around 1-1.25 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
